On Fri, Aug 23, 2002 at 07:18:08PM +0300, Amir Seginer wrote: > I'm using Lyx-1.2.0. (haven't upgraded to 1.2.1 yet). > > When I type in math-mode the symbol "~" from the keyboard (instead of > \sim) I get "~" in the Lyx display, however nothing shows up in the final > postscript output.
~ acts as a non breakable space in LaTeX. As far as I can tell there is no automatic conversion into \sim. > This problem did not occur on earlier versions (1.1.6fix4), which gave > the symbol in both the Lyx display and the final postscript output. > > I understand if this is a change in the behavior of Lyx, but I think it > would be nice for a consistency between the final output and what Lyx > displays (I would of course prefer the old behavior of getting ~ in the > final output).
